## Service Accounts — StormFan Alert Fan-Out

The fan-out worker authenticates to the internal dispatch tier using the svc-stormfan account. Rotate quarterly; scopes are limited to publish-only on alert topics. If deliveries stall during your shift, verify the worker is using the current credential, reproduced below for reference.

API key for kaweg-hahif: kto4_rAjZ

Ticket #4182 — Cron drift in Larkspur scheduler hooks

Plugin jobs registered via the Larkspur hook API are firing up to 90 seconds late on shared tiers. Cause traced to a tick-batching change in the dispatcher. Fix queues per-plugin timers separately. Plugin authors can verify against the patched build identified by the token below.

pipeline stamp: htk31_f769b577b3028a4e9958e5bb8d1259a

To all sales leads: effective next quarter, Bravenmark is replacing the flat 4% commission with a tiered model. Tier one covers renewals, tier two new logos, tier three multi-year contracts on the Orlick suite. Accelerators kick in at 110% of quota; draws remain unchanged. Payout timing moves from monthly to bi-weekly, and split-credit disputes now route through regional leads rather than finance. Full tables are in the compensation workbook. The strategic reasoning behind these changes is noted confidentially below.

internal memo for taguf-kafop: Novmirax Group plans to lower the Oliius list price by 42.0 percent in March. The board signed off on a budget of $367.8 million for Project Belael. The renewal with Drumirax Logistics closes at $302.4 million a year, 54.0 percent below the last contract. Project Kelys slips by a full year because of the staffing delay.